    The dark night and the ghost are lions that have existed in history. The prototype of the two is the famous cannibal lion of Chavo. When the African colonists were laying railways in the local area, people often died of exhaustion and sickness. The dead were usually handed over to the workers. Workers who have been tired for a day threw the carcasses into the wild without much thought. It is difficult to hunt in the dry season, so lions pick up ready-made ones to fill their stomachs.
